ხშირი კითხვა: SQLite-ის რომელ ვერსიას იყენებს Android?

Android API SQLite Version
API 24 3.9
API 21 3.8
API 11 3.7
API 8 3.6

არის SQLite ჩაშენებული Android-ში?

SQLite არის ღია წყაროს SQL მონაცემთა ბაზა, რომელიც ინახავს მონაცემებს ტექსტური ფაილისთვის მოწყობილობაზე. Android შემოდის SQLite მონაცემთა ბაზის დანერგვით.

რა არის Android SQLite?

SQLite არის ღია კოდის რელაციური მონაცემთა ბაზა, ანუ გამოიყენება მონაცემთა ბაზის ოპერაციების შესასრულებლად ანდროიდის მოწყობილობებზე, როგორიცაა მონაცემთა ბაზიდან მუდმივი მონაცემების შენახვა, მანიპულირება ან ამოღება. ის ჩაშენებულია ანდროიდში ნაგულისხმევად. ასე რომ, არ არის საჭირო მონაცემთა ბაზის დაყენების ან ადმინისტრირების დავალების შესრულება.

How can I see the SQLite database in Android?

თქვენ ჯერ უნდა ამოიღოთ მონაცემთა ბაზის ფაილი მოწყობილობიდან, შემდეგ გახსენით იგი SQLite DB ბრაუზერში.
...
ამის გაკეთება შეგიძლიათ:

  1. adb ჭურვი.
  2. cd /go/to/მონაცემთა ბაზა.
  3. sqlite3 მონაცემთა ბაზა. დბ.
  4. sqlite> მოთხოვნაში ჩაწერეთ. მაგიდები. ეს მოგცემთ მონაცემთა ბაზაში არსებულ ყველა ცხრილს. db ფაილი.
  5. აირჩიეთ * ცხრილიდან 1;

24 აგვისტო 2015 წელი

უნდა დავაყენო SQLite Android-ისთვის?

SQLite არის Android-ის სტანდარტული ბიბლიოთეკის ნაწილი; მისი კლასები შეგიძლიათ ნახოთ ანდროიდში. მონაცემთა ბაზა. sqlite. თქვენ არ გჭირდებათ მისი დაყენება.

რომელი მონაცემთა ბაზა არის საუკეთესო Android-ისთვის?

მობილური დეველოპერების უმეტესობა ალბათ იცნობს SQLite-ს. ის არსებობს 2000 წლიდან და, სავარაუდოდ, ყველაზე ხშირად გამოყენებული რელაციური მონაცემთა ბაზის ძრავაა მსოფლიოში. SQLite-ს აქვს მრავალი სარგებელი, რომელსაც ჩვენ ყველა ვაღიარებთ, რომელთაგან ერთ-ერთი არის მისი მშობლიური მხარდაჭერა Android-ზე.

რისთვის გამოიყენება SQLite?

ის შეიძლება გამოყენებულ იქნას მონაცემთა ბაზის შესაქმნელად, ცხრილების განსაზღვრისთვის, რიგების ჩასმა და შესაცვლელად, მოთხოვნების გასაშვებად და SQLite მონაცემთა ბაზის ფაილის მართვისთვის. ის ასევე ემსახურება როგორც მაგალითი აპლიკაციების დასაწერად, რომლებიც იყენებენ SQLite ბიბლიოთეკას. SQLite იყენებს ავტომატური რეგრესიის ტესტირებას ყოველი გამოშვების წინ.

რა თვისებები აქვს SQLite-ს?

იგი მხარს უჭერს სტანდარტული ურთიერთობების მონაცემთა ბაზის ფუნქციებს, როგორიცაა SQL სინტაქსი, ტრანზაქციები და SQL განცხადებები.
...
SQLite მხარს უჭერს მხოლოდ 3 მონაცემთა ტიპს:

  • ტექსტი (სტრიქონის მსგავსი) – მონაცემთა ტიპის შენახვის შესანახად.
  • მთელი რიცხვი (ისევე როგორც int) – მთელი რიცხვის პირველადი გასაღების შესანახად.
  • რეალური (როგორც ორმაგი) - ხანგრძლივი მნიშვნელობების შესანახად.

როგორ ამოიღებდით მონაცემებს SQLite ცხრილიდან?

პირველი, დაამყარეთ კავშირი SQLite მონაცემთა ბაზასთან Connection ობიექტის შექმნით. შემდეგი, შექმენით კურსორის ობიექტი Connection ობიექტის კურსორის მეთოდის გამოყენებით. შემდეგ შეასრულეთ SELECT განცხადება. ამის შემდეგ გამოიძახეთ კურსორის ობიექტის fetchall() მეთოდი მონაცემების მისაღებად.

სად ინახება SQLite მონაცემთა ბაზები?

Android SDK უზრუნველყოფს სპეციალურ API-ებს, რომლებიც დეველოპერებს საშუალებას აძლევს გამოიყენონ SQLite მონაცემთა ბაზები თავიანთ აპლიკაციებში. SQLite ფაილები ჩვეულებრივ ინახება შიდა მეხსიერებაში /data/data//databases-ში. თუმცა, არ არსებობს შეზღუდვები მონაცემთა ბაზების სხვაგან შექმნაზე.

როგორ ვნახო SQLite მონაცემთა ბაზა?

Open flag: Flag for openDatabase(File, SQLiteDatabase. OpenParams) to open the database without support for localized collators. Open flag: Flag for openDatabase(File, SQLiteDatabase. OpenParams) to open the database for reading only.

როგორ დავუკავშირდე SQLite მონაცემთა ბაზას?

როგორ დავუკავშირდეთ SQLite-ს ბრძანების ხაზიდან

  1. შედით თქვენს A2 ჰოსტინგის ანგარიშში SSH-ის გამოყენებით.
  2. ბრძანების სტრიქონში ჩაწერეთ შემდეგი ბრძანება, შეცვალეთ example.db მონაცემთა ბაზის ფაილის სახელით, რომლის გამოყენებაც გსურთ: sqlite3 example.db. …
  3. მონაცემთა ბაზაში შესვლის შემდეგ, შეგიძლიათ გამოიყენოთ რეგულარული SQL განცხადებები მოთხოვნების გასაშვებად, ცხრილების შესაქმნელად, მონაცემების ჩასართავად და სხვა.

გჭირდებათ SQLite-ის დაყენება?

SQLite არ საჭიროებს „ინსტალაციას“ მის გამოყენებამდე. არ არსებობს "დაყენების" პროცედურა. არ არსებობს სერვერის პროცესი, რომელიც საჭიროებს დაწყებას, შეჩერებას ან კონფიგურაციას. არ არის საჭირო ადმინისტრატორმა შექმნას მონაცემთა ბაზის ახალი მაგალითი ან მიანიჭოს წვდომის ნებართვა მომხმარებლებს.

როგორ დავიწყო SQLite?

დაიწყეთ sqlite3 პროგრამა ბრძანების სტრიქონში „sqlite3“ აკრეფით, სურვილისამებრ მოჰყვება ფაილის სახელი, რომელიც შეიცავს SQLite მონაცემთა ბაზას (ან ZIP არქივს). თუ დასახელებული ფაილი არ არსებობს, ავტომატურად შეიქმნება მონაცემთა ბაზის ახალი ფაილი მოცემული სახელით.

რა არის კონტენტის პროვაიდერის გამოყენება Android-ში?

კონტენტის პროვაიდერებს შეუძლიათ დაეხმარონ აპლიკაციას მართოს წვდომა თავის მიერ შენახულ, სხვა აპების მიერ შენახულ მონაცემებზე და უზრუნველყოს სხვა აპებთან მონაცემების გაზიარების საშუალება. ისინი ათავსებენ მონაცემებს და უზრუნველყოფენ მონაცემთა უსაფრთხოების განსაზღვრის მექანიზმებს.

მოგწონთ ეს პოსტი? გთხოვთ გაუზიაროთ თქვენს მეგობრებს:
OS დღეს